Kliknięcie narysowanego obiektu

Mam klasę o nazwieShape dziedziczy od JPanel.

Szereg podklas z kolei rozszerzaShape klasy, po jednej dla każdego rodzaju kształtu.

Każdy kształt ma swój własny przesłoniętypaint() metoda, która rysuje odpowiedni kształt.

Chciałbym móc kliknąć dowolny kształt i próbuję teraz wdrożyć tę logikę. Pamiętaj, że każdy kształt został dodany do tablicy arrayList.

Jednak instrukcja zawiera zawsze zwraca false, nawet gdy wyraźnie kliknąłem wewnątrz kształtu.

Jakieś pomysły?

questionAnswers(2)

yourAnswerToTheQuestion